ALL >> Education >> View Article
Mastering Essential Data Engineering Skills

In the era of big data and digital transformation, data engineering has emerged as a critical discipline that powers the effective management, processing, and analysis of data. With the rapid growth of data volumes and complexity, mastering essential data engineering skills through a comprehensive data engineer course has become crucial for individuals and organizations seeking to leverage data as a strategic asset.
1. Proficiency in Programming and Scripting
Data engineering requires a strong foundation in programming and scripting languages. Python, with its rich ecosystem of libraries and frameworks, is widely used in data engineering for tasks such as data manipulation, transformation, and pipeline development. Additionally, proficiency in languages like SQL, Java, Scala, or R is valuable for interacting with databases, building data infrastructure, and implementing complex data processing logic.
2. Data Warehousing
Understanding the principles and practices of data warehousing is fundamental to data engineering. Data engineers should be well-versed in concepts like star and snowflake schemas, ...
... dimensional modeling, and ETL (Extract, Transform, Load) processes. Proficiency in data warehousing technologies like Apache Hive, Amazon Redshift, or Google BigQuery, acquired through a comprehensive data engineer training course, equips data engineers with the tools to design and implement scalable and efficient data storage and retrieval systems.
3. Data Modeling and Database Design
Data modeling skills enable data engineers to design efficient and optimized databases. They should be familiar with conceptual, logical, and physical data modeling techniques to represent data structures and relationships accurately. Mastery of tools like ER/Studio, Lucidchart, or SQL Power Architect facilitates the creation of robust data models that align with business requirements and enable efficient data processing.
4. Proficiency in Data Integration
Data integration is a crucial aspect of data engineering that involves combining data from various sources into a unified and coherent format. Data engineers must possess the skills to integrate disparate data systems, including databases, APIs, and data streams. Proficiency in tools like Apache Kafka, Apache Nifi, or Talend, often gained through a reputable data engineer certification, facilitates seamless data integration and ensures the availability of clean, reliable, and up-to-date data for analysis.
5. Knowledge of Distributed Systems and Big Data Technologies
As data volumes continue to grow exponentially, data engineers must be familiar with distributed systems and big data technologies. They should understand concepts like parallel processing, distributed computing, and fault tolerance. Proficiency in technologies such as Apache Hadoop, Apache Spark, or Apache Flink enables data engineers to process and analyze large-scale datasets efficiently, extracting valuable insights from the vast sea of information.
6. Data Quality Assurance and Governance
Data quality is paramount in data engineering. Data engineers should have a solid understanding of data quality assessment techniques and be able to implement data cleansing and validation processes. They must also be well-versed in data governance principles and practices, ensuring compliance with regulations and maintaining data integrity and security. Proficiency in tools like Apache Atlas or Collibra, often acquired through a reputable data engineer training institute, aids in data governance and quality assurance efforts.
7. Automation and Workflow Management
Efficiency is key in data engineering, and automation plays a vital role in achieving it. Data engineers should possess skills in workflow management tools like Apache Airflow, Luigi, or Apache Oozie to orchestrate data pipelines and automate ETL processes. This enables the seamless execution of data workflows, reduces manual effort, and enhances productivity, allowing data engineers to focus on higher-value tasks.
Conclusion
Mastering essential data engineering skills is a transformative step towards unlocking the power of data. From programming and scripting to data modeling, integration, and automation, each skill contributes to the seamless management and processing of data. By investing in developing these skills through the best data engineer course, individuals and organizations can harness the full potential of their data, driving data excellence, informed decision-making, and sustainable growth in today's data-driven world.
Add Comment
Education Articles
1. Can Ielts Academic Be Used For Immigration?Author: lily bloom
2. A Course On The Importance Of Upskilling At The College Level
Author: stem-xpert
3. Global Clinical Trials: Unveiling India’s Booming Market Outlook For 2025!
Author: Aakash jha
4. The Power Of Micro-influencers: Why They Matter More Than Ever
Author: dev
5. Digital Marketing Course In Dadar
Author: Sanchi
6. The Best Sre Course Online In India | Sre Training
Author: krishna
7. Top Google Cloud Ai Training In Chennai - Visualpath
Author: visualpath
8. Best Dynamics 365 Business Central Online Training - Hyderabad
Author: Susheel
9. The Best Data Engineering Course In Hyderabad - 2025
Author: naveen
10. Microsoft Dynamics 365 Course In Hyderabad | D365 Training
Author: Hari
11. Top Salesforce Marketing Cloud Training In Ameerpet
Author: Visualpath
12. Top Snowflake Course In Ameerpet | Snowflake Online Training
Author: Pravin
13. List Of Top Online Ma Colleges In India
Author: Study Jagat
14. Scrum Master Training In Bangalore | Scrum Master Classes
Author: visualpath
15. Mendix Online Training | Mendix Online Certification Course
Author: himaram